Aman Feed  (DHA:AMANFEED) Long-Term Debt Explanation

Long-Term Debt is the sum of the carrying values as of the balance sheet date of all long-term debt, which is debt initially having maturities due after one year or beyond the operating cycle, if longer, but excluding the portions thereof scheduled to be repaid within one year or the normal operating cycle, if longer. Long-Term Debt includes notes payable, bonds payable, mortgage loans, convertible debt, subordinated debt and other types of long term debt.

Aman Feed Business Description

Address 2 Ishakha Avenue, Sector 6,Uttara, Dhaka, BGD, 1230
Aman Feed PLC is engaged in production, distribution and sale of poultry feed, fish feed, shrimp feed and cattle feed.
